Dollar Sign Replacement Proposal Ignites Social Media Debate

Context of the Proposal
Bhavish Aggarwal, co-founder of Ola, recently proposed that the Dollar sign on keyboards should be replaced with the Indian Rupee symbol. This audacious statement arose from discussions on economic sovereignty and representation in digital interfaces.
Social Media Reaction
The response from users has been overwhelmingly mixed. While some support the Rupee’s prominence, others have criticized the feasibility of such a change. Memes and tweets flooded platforms as users expressed their thoughts candidly.
Impacts and Implications
- Economic Identity: Advocates believe this move could foster a greater sense of national identity.
- Practical Challenges: Critics argue about the practicality of implementing such changes across all digital platforms.
- Global Perspective: Comparisons to how other currencies, especially the Euro and Yen, are handled in tech spaces.
